Attendees: John, Silenio, Anton, Anthony, Mike, Curtis, Dana, Libing, Grant
Minutes
- Some minor polish to presentation of content assist
- Updated hover support to show deprecated state of functions, @see references
- Added plugin for controlling tern, stopping it, showing/controlling tern plugins
- Added a tern preference page to allow advanced users to configure it
- Minified the tern worker in our build to improve load performance
- Enabled csslint for embedded style blocks in HTML files
- Have a working demo of standalone editor with JS tooling working, connecting it to Node-RED as a test case
- Investigating enabling HTTP2/SPDY on the Orion server
- Investigating design for showing more verbose deploy feedback
- Git page was broken by Chrome 43, released a fix in stable branch
- Working on improving editor page load performance
- Experimenting with merging plugins to see how much speedup it gives
- Experimenting with workers for other plugins (currently using it for Tern only)
